In Greek mythology, Panacea (Greek Πανάκεια, Panakeia), a goddess of universal remedy, was the daughter of Asclepius and Epione. Panacea and her four sisters each performed a facet of Apollo's art: • Panacea (the goddess of universal health) • Hygieia ("Hygiene", the goddess/personification of health, cleanliness, and sanitation)
